Abstract
The French utopian socialism Saint-Simon devoted his life o seek the social science theory from the practical point of view, and used philosophy to promote the formation of industrial and scientific system, striving for the happiness of mankind. When Saint-Simon was forty-two years old, he proposed to establish anew philosophy. The law of social development thoughts is the basic core of Saint-Simon's new philosophy system. He emphasized that the determinism is the philosophy guiding principle of scientific methodology, provided the main task of philosophers, and prospected the future development of society. To some extent, Saint-Simon's new philosophy is close to historical materialism and materialistic principle, which is Saint-Simon's biggest contribution. Saint-Simon Marx not only provided theoretical basis for the Marx's theory of scientific socialism, but also provided the basis for the establishment of Marx's philosophy.
